Sony has recently announced the Madden 09 PSP Entertainment Pack, and it includes a copy of EA's upcoming football simulator and a very slick-looking metallic blue PSP. The entire bundle will retail for $199.99 and go on sale right alongside Madden 09 on August 12, which is bound to be a big day for game retailers across the US. And there's more, as you can see by that picture- you also get a 1GB Memory Stick Pro Duo and a couple sweet little bonuses; one for all you die-hard pigskin fans and one for any music fan. There's a NFL Films presentation, "NFL: In Just One Play," and a voucher to download Beats from the PlayStation Network through the PSP's PC hookup. Sony says this cool piece of software uses "beat-tracking technology to create gameplay from any song that the player supplies."
